原文:springboot 使用@ControllerAdvice注解全局处理系统异常

转自:https: blog. cto.com chenhva 在日常的开发中,我们很多时候不停的使用try catch来处理异常,这样的代码重复性强,通过 controllerAdvice 注解来实现可以全局定义异常,大大减少代码的try catch。 import com.vicrab.api.bean.OperateCode import com.vicrab.api.server.mode ...

2020-09-21 16:35 0 578 推荐指数:

查看详情

springboot多个@ControllerAdvice全局异常处理

背景 在springboot多模块中, common模块有全局异常处理, A模块引用了common模块, 且A模块中有自己的全局异常处理, 在有些服务中是A中的全局异常处理生效, 有些服务中是common模块中的全局异常处理生效. 非常疑惑, 了解后写下此篇. 简单描述 先加载 ...

Sun Apr 26 23:04:00 CST 2020 1 4660
十四、springboot全局处理异常(@ControllerAdvice + @ExceptionHandler)

1.@ControllerAdvice 1.场景一 在构建RestFul的今天,我们一般会限定好返回数据的格式比如:   但有时却往往会产生一些bug。这时候就破坏了返回数据的一致性,导致调用者无法解析。所以我们常常会定义一个全局异常拦截器。 2.场景二   对于与数据库 ...

Thu May 17 23:10:00 CST 2018 0 854
@ControllerAdvice 全局异常处理

使用@ControllerAdvice 定义 全局异常处理 当需要将自定义结果写入Response时,有更好的选择:ResponseEntityExceptionHandler( 作为 @ControllerAdvice的基类) 如下,在Service中 ...

Mon Dec 09 21:38:00 CST 2019 0 548
使用@ControllerAdvice处理异常

, @GetMapping注解中。接下来我将通过代码展示如何使用这些注解,以及处理异常。 1.注解的介 ...

Thu Apr 09 19:01:00 CST 2020 0 655
使用Spring MVC的@ControllerAdvice注解做Json的异常处理

一,本文介绍Spring MVC的自定义异常处理,即在Controller中抛出自定义的异常时,客户端收到更友好的JSON格式的提示。而不是常见的报错页面。 二,场景描述:实现公用API,验证API key的逻辑,放在拦截器中判断(等同于在Controller中)并抛出异常,用户收到类似下图 ...

Tue Aug 21 17:50:00 CST 2018 0 743
全局异常捕获处理-@ControllerAdvice+@HandleException

涂涂影院管理系统这个demo中有个异常管理的标签,用于捕获 涂涂影院APP用户异常信息 ,有小伙伴好奇,排除APP,后台端的是如何处理全局异常的,故项目中的实际应用已记之。 关于目前的异常处理使用全局异常处理之前,就目前我们是如何处理程序中的异常信息 ...

Fri May 24 03:07:00 CST 2019 0 2385
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M